Cool pics Chief. The mystery box is a ring modulator...I forget which brand, but I do recognize it from that pic. Another interesting thing is that out of the three DSL heads JB had/has, only one of them sounded good, and JB and his tech don't know why. Marshall sent JB the first head as a demo, which JB refused to give back! Then JB bought two more and neither of them sounded anywhere near like the first one. So, JB sent the first one to Marshall, hoping they would figure out why it sounded so good, and they couldn't provide an explanation. They said it was exactly like all the others they produce commercially, nothing different or special that they could find, other than the way it sounded.
They are still stumped to this day...
